ぬこ将軍です🐈
Pythonというプログラミング言語を、最初はひたすら勉強でしたがちょっとした業務改善とかに使い始めて約1年。最近ではPythonを使う頻度も楽しさも増す日々です。
結構飽きっぽい自分がなぜここまで続けられているのかふと考えてみました。
ということで今回は「Pythonがプログラミング未経験者にオススメな理由」について書こうかと思います。
現代のデジタル時代においてますます重要性を増しているプログラミングですが、その中でもPythonは初心者にとっても取り組みやすい言語として人気です。
この記事ではプログラミング未経験者にPythonをおすすめする理由について、自分なりに考えて詳しく解説してみます。
- プログラミング言語Pythonが気になっているけど、自分にも出来るか不安。。。
そんな方々の参考になりましたら幸いです。その魅力を知れば、あなたもきっとPythonの虜になること間違いなしです!
プログラミング未経験者にPythonをオススメしたい理由
魅力その1:Pythonの構文はシンプル
print("Hellow!World!")でHellow!World!という文字列が出力され、string = "Hellow!World!"でstringという変数にHellow!World!という文字列が代入される。
そして、print(string)でもHellow!World!という文字列が出力される。
こんな感じでPythonは、他のプログラミング言語に比べて構文がシンプルで読みやすいです。学生時代に全くプログラミング言語を見たことが無く、30代から勉強し始めた私のような初心者でも理解しやすいです。
自分はPython以外にもjavascriptというプログラミング言語を少しだけ勉強していたことがありますが、Pythonの方が英文を書くような感じで特殊記号を使うことが少なく、簡単な印象です。
文法のルールが少なく英語に似た表現を使われることが多いので、Pythonを使ってプログラミングの基礎を学ぶのは容易だと思います。
魅力その2:Pythonには豊富なリソース・サポート・コミュニティがある
シンプルゆえにPythonは非常に人気のある言語で、インターネット上で「python ○○」で検索すれば情報源やチュートリアルが豊富に出てきます。
さらに初心者向けの学習教材も充実しており、これも検索すれば沢山Python関係の本が出てきます。
ちなみに自分が実際に購入したPython本は2冊です。
1冊目はPythonを始めてみようと思って買ったときの本。余計な説明がなくサクサク勉強できます。
2冊目はAIに興味が出てきて買った本です。機械学習に興味のある方は、この本でもPythonの基本が勉強できるのでオススメです!
さらにはPython系のコミュニティやフォーラムも沢山あります!
英語がある程度読み書き出来れば世界中のPythonコミュニティのメンバーが助けてくれるし、Pythonの公式ドキュメントも読めるため、Pythonの勉強や実践がしやすい環境が整っていると言えます。
ちなみに自分は英語ができませんが、たまたま同じ事業所にPythonに詳しい人が居たのでその人に助けられながらPythonの学習を進めています。
独学も良いですが、誰かと一緒にできる環境というのも大事だとしみじみ思います。
魅力その3:Pythonには多岐にわたる用途がある
リソースやコミュニティの豊富さもさることながらPythonは汎用性も高く、ウェブ開発、データ分析、人工知能、科学計算など様々な用途・幅広い分野で活用されています。
さらにPythonには豊富なライブラリやフレームワークが存在しており、それらを活用することで効率的にプログラムを作成できます。
自分の場合はjupyternotebookでPythonを使っていますが、1セルごとに自分が書いたコードの結果が分かるので修正が分かりやすくて初心者には良いと思います。
こんな感じで、Pythonは自分の興味や目標に合わせて活用することができます。このブログではまだ業務効率化の例しか書いていませんが、そのうち他の事例も書こうと思っていますのでご期待ください(笑)
Pythonでの業務効率化事例はコチラ
⇓
【手軽にPDFを結合!】Pythonを使ったスマートなファイル結合テクニック - ゼロからの業務効率化ノート
魅力その4:Pythonは産業界での需要が高い
その汎用性の高さからPythonは産業界でも非常に需要が高いプログラミング言語となっており、企業でもPythonを使った開発者を求めています。
特にデータサイエンスや機械学習の分野では特に重宝されており、Pythonに関して調べると機械学習やデータ分析に関する話とセットなんてことは良くあります。
自分の会社でも最近になってようやく、Pythonとかノーコードツールとかを勉強するコミュニティが本格的に始動しました。
このような状況なので、たとえプログラミング未経験であっても今からPythonを学ぶことで将来的に高い就業機会を得られたり、キャリアの可能性が広がるのではないでしょうか?
「ひそかにプログラミングを勉強して周囲と差を広げたい!」という秘めた野心を持った方にはビッグチャンスだと私は思います🐈
Pythonの魅力まとめ
自分が考える、プログラミング未経験者にオススメしたい理由およびPythonの魅力についてまとめると以下の通りです。
- 英文のようにシンプルな構文
- 豊富なリソース・サポート・コミュニティ
- 多岐にわたる用途
- 産業界での需要の高さ
約1年間学んでおりますが、Pythonはプログラミング初心者にとって非常に学びやすいプログラミング言語だと感じます。
またPythonの人気も需要も非常に高く、用途も多岐にわたります。
シンプルな構文、豊富な学習リソース、幅広い用途、そして産業界での需要の高さなど、Pythonを学ぶことはプログラミングの世界への入り口として最適です。
ぜひPythonで、自分の可能性を広げてみませんか?